When i removed the usb port from the board some of the soldering pads were missing. First i tried to replace them with some pads from dead board but the board was so eaten i didn’t had any copper to solder them. So with a very thin sand paper i scratched the surface then i could see the copper. I’ve seen that people make bridges with copper wires and solder them slightly up from where usually the legs of the usb port land. But where do i need to put the wires, is there another layer on the pcb? Because i don’t see any trace paths.

you have to find schematics and do a jumper from the trace which you have broken. you can prevent this from happening by using flux and a higher temperature to remove the charging port. check on google images for huawei y625 charging ways. you can find diagrams of which traces you need to do bridge a connection from.
